Effect of Wheelchair Mass, Tire Type and Tire Pressure on Physical Strain and Wheelchair Propulsion Technique (2013)

September 1, 2023 by Ashley Zhinin.
Shoulder pain is exceedingly common for individuals with lower limb disability that require a manual wheelchair. Researchers in the Netherlands sought to identify easily changeable factors of wheelchair structure that could facilitate easier motion with less energy. Using Occupational Therapy Process Addressing Sleep-Related Problems in Neurorehabilitation: A Cross-sectional Modeling Study (2021)

September 1, 2023 by Ashley Zhinin.
The research team developed a questionnaire consisting of 12 questions investigating demographic information and current practice in addressing sleep-related problems in neurorehabilitation units, including OT assessments and treatment.
